Mungaha Population - Sidhi, Madhya Pradesh
Mungaha is a small village located in Churhat Tehsil of Sidhi district, Madhya Pradesh with total 16 families residing. The Mungaha village has population of 72 of which 36 are males while 36 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Mungaha village population of children with age 0-6 is 2 which makes up 2.78 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Mungaha village is 1000 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Mungaha as per census is 1000,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Mungaha village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Mungaha village was 81.43 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Mungaha Male literacy stands at 94.29 % while female literacy rate was 68.57 %.
